Keeping Your Outdoor Kitchen Functional in the Issaquah Climate

Winterizing Your Outdoor Kitchen in PNW Backyards

Shielding your exterior cooking space from the damp, chilly Issaquah winters is critical. Begin by flushing water lines to prevent freezing, especially for plumbed beverage centers. Cover all appliances and store removable components; consider adding protective jackets to vulnerable zones. A well-winterized kitchen ensures reliable entertaining capability.

Utility Compliance in PNW Backyard Builds

Plumbing gas, water, or electricity to your backyard cooking zone must follow Washington state regulations. Natural gas lines require a licensed professional, while electrical circuits need GFCI protection and underground conduit. For plumbed ice makers, backflow prevention is mandatory. Always consult a licensed landscape contractor to ensure your grill ventilation systems meet code.
